Heavy duty flat wagon type Rlmmp 700 of the Deutsche Bundesbahn (DB)
Marked and painted true to the original The term heavy-duty wagon is now only used colloquially, since it no longer finds a counterpart in the international classification of freight wagons according to UIC. It is generally understood to mean a relatively short flat bogie with a flat floor for the transport of heavy loads such as machines, tanks or slabs. |

Hobbytrain 3 pieces CIWL Set 1 Vienna-Nice-Cannes-Express, Ep.I - N gauge
WNC Express Set 1: 1x new baggage car 2x sleeping cars The Vienna-Nice-Cannes-Express was a luxury train operated by the Compagnie Internationale des Wagons-Lits. From 1896 to 1939 it operated between Vienna and the French-Italian Riviera, in some cases already from Saint Petersburg. Because of his popularity with the Russian and Habsburg aristocracy, he was given the nickname "Train des GrandDucs" before 1914. The CIWL first introduced the train in winter 1896/97 in order to satisfy the demand of the European upper class, whose most important holiday destination in winter was the Riviera, outside of France and Great Britain. Like all the luxury trains of the CIWL at that time, the Vienna-Nice-Cannes-Express consisted exclusively of sleeping cars, dining cars and luggage cars. Until 1914 these were the usual CIWL teak wagons. In the model, the complete 6-part train is realized with two brand new 4-axle luggage, three sleeping and one dining car. The destination signs of the sleeping cars are authentically different. The sleeping and dining cars have interior lighting and numerous details and attachments both inside and out. The VW T3 from Volkswagen was the third generation of the VW van. It was produced from 1979 to 1992 and was the last transporter series with rear-wheel drive. After the VW 411/412 from 1968, the T3 was the last new development of a Volkswagen vehicle with an air-cooled rear engine. Like all VW buses, the third generation also had the type designation type 2. Within this series, the individual models T1, T2 and T3 were numbered internally.
